Philadelphia Phillies @
Cincinnati Reds
1960-07-04 Β· Day game Β· Crosley Field Β· Att: 15280 Β· 2:03
Philadelphia Phillies defeated Cincinnati Reds 5β2. Philadelphia Phillies put up 2 in the 4th. Gene Conley earned the win. Pancho Herrera went 2-for-3 with 1 HR and 2 RBI.
